Answer:

x=1/2

Explanation:

6(x+3)=21

Step 1: Distribute 6 into (x+3)

6(x) = 6x

6(3) = 18

We're left with 6x+18=21

Step 2: Subtract 18 from 21

6x=21-18

6x=3

Step 3: Divide each side by 6 to isolate x

x=3/6

Step 4: Simplify

x=1/2
